Tech Armor slows your power cooldowns, but it isn't too big a deal in the long run. Taking Slam as a bonus power is a good compliment to Warp, as Slam can detonate Warp (and vice versa).

I play as a more damage focused Sentinel (+power damage and cooldown reduction for Tech Armor, ignore Throw, maximize grenade capacity and damage, maximize Warp damage, etc).
